Turkey's daily electricity consumption decreased by 7.96% on Sunday compared to the previous day, reaching 917,753 million megawatt-hours, according to official figures of the Turkish Electricity Transmission Corporation (TEIAS) on Monday.
Hourly power consumption peaked at 42,038 megawatt-hours at 22.00 local time on Sunday data from TEIAS showed. The country's electricity usage was at its lowest at 31,655 megawatt-hours at 07.00 local time (0400 GMT).
Electricity production amounted to 929,485 million megawatt-hours on Sunday, marking a 7.83% decrease from Saturday.
Turkey's electricity production from natural gas plants constituted 34.8% of total electricity consumption, wind energy plants held a 12.4% while imported coal plants comprised 17.1%.
On Sunday, Turkey's electricity exports amounted to 14,572 megawatt-hours, while imports totaled 3,379 megawatt-hours.
